Listed by RE/MAX RevolutionNewly renovated to fastidious perfection, this stunning two-story home is positioned in a quiet cul-de-sac on a fully useable 800m2 block. Situated in a premier pocket of Shailer Park where you are immersed in bushland and surrounded by other quality homes, this is the perfect opportunity to secure a beautiful home in an idyllic, family friendly location.
Upper-Level Highlights:
Elevated to capture the leafy views, the upper level is light, bright and breezy. High angled ceilings add to the sense of wide-open space and light timber floorboards add warmth.
Here, you will find a lounge room, a separate elegant sitting room, and a large dining room. The casual areas all spill out onto the covered alfresco entertaining verandah. This is the perfect spot to entertain family & friends, whilst soaking in the tranquil outlook from your elevated position.
At the heart of the casual living zones is a brand-new Hamptons kitchen with elegant gold hardware and shaker style cabinetry finished in a unique soft pistachio tone. Superbly appointed, the kitchen features a full range of new appliances including a dishwasher, Westinghouse oven and an electric cooktop. There is an abundance of both bench and cupboard space, along with a good-sized pantry. Perch at the kitchen bench for a quick snack or enjoy a meal in the adjacent dining room.
You will find three of the four bedrooms on the upper level, all with built-ins and ceiling fans.
The master bedroom is privately positioned at the rear of the home and features a full wall of built-ins, along with a stunning new ensuite with gold hardware, floor to ceiling tiles and timber look cabinetry.
Also on the upper level is a brand-new main bathroom featuring floor to ceiling tiles, elegant gold hardware and timber look cabinetry with a stylish arched mirror. There is also a shower/soaker tub combined.
Lower-level Highlights:
Downstairs is a versatile space, ideal for adapting to your families' changing needs over time.
There is a rumpus /living room, along with the fourth bedroom, a new toilet room and new laundry room. Ideal for older children craving their own space or perfect for guests, this area could also work equally well for those with a home-based business.
The lower level enjoys its own covered entertaining area and access to the level rear yard.
Outdoors, you will find:
The large and level grassed rear yard provides an abundance of space for children and pets to play. There is also the bonus of drive through access via the front gates.
There is plenty of room to add a pool and/or a large shed within the fully fenced yard.
Vehicle Accommodation:
Your vehicles will be secure in the double lock-up garaging. The garage has additional storage space and a workshop area. The drive through side access to the block allows room for additional vehicles, a boat, caravan or trailer all off-street.
Other quality features include:
• Laundry shute
• Air-conditioning and ceiling fans
• Under stair storage
• Freshly painted throughout
Location:
The home enjoys a private and peaceful position towards the peak of a small cul-de-sac. The location of this property is renowned by locals as being one of the most sought after and picturesque pockets in Shailer Park. Key conveniences include:
• A 5 minutes' drive to the Logan Hyperdome and its bus service.
• Within short driving distance to a choice of public and private schools (3 min drive to Shailer Park State Primary & High Schools; 4 mins to Kimberly Park Primary; 6 mins to St Matthews Catholic Primary; 7 mins to Chisholm Catholic College; 9 mins to John Paul College).
• Quick access to the M1 and within approximately thirty minutes' drive to the CBD and to the Gold Coast.
